Subject: iTunes mod?
   I'd like to make a mod (or resurrect wTunes Skin) to control iTunes using the new functionality. How do I link a click on a UI object to the iTunes controls, and what are they called?

Q u o t e:
AFAIK the scripting interface won't be able to call the new functions, they will only be accessible via keybindings.

Q u o t e:
Patch 1.12 includes controls for iTunes if you are using the Macintosh Client. Blizzard said there are technical difficulties preventing inclusion in the Windows client. If you have the Mac Client you should visit the Macintosh forum and ask there.


There are no hard roadblocks, but there is a bit more work to put this feature on Windows. It's being looked at.
